GROUND BEEF TACO DIP
Beef up your snack game and serve this easy taco dip with meat. Full of classic flavors, it's a little extra satisfaction for those football-day appetites. -Errika Perry, Green Bay, Wisconsin
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Appetizers
Time 20m
Yield 24 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a large skillet, cook and crumble beef over medium heat until no longer pink, 4-6 minutes; drain. Add water and one envelope taco seasoning; cook until thickened. Cool slightly., Beat sour cream, cream cheese and remaining taco seasoning until blended. Spread in a 3-qt. dish; add ground beef. Top with lettuce, cheddar, tomatoes, pepper and olives.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 116 calories, Fat 7g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 30mg cholesterol, Sodium 378mg sodium, Carbohydrate 7g carbohydrate (2g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 7g protein.

BAKED TACO DIP
This hot taco dip is sure to please everyone, kids included. Serve with tortilla chips.
Provided by ChefLes
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Dips and Spreads Recipes Cheese Dips and Spreads Recipes
Time 40m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
- Spread cream cheese in an even layer in the bottom of an 8x8-inch baking dish.
- Cook and stir beef in a skillet over medium-high heat until browned and cooked through, 5 to 10 minutes. Add water and taco seasoning mix; stir. Simmer until most of the liquid evaporates, 3 to 5 minutes.
- Spread meat mixture over the cream cheese in the baking dish. Pour salsa over meat mixture. Top with Cheddar cheese.
- Bake taco dip in preheated oven until bubbling and cheese is melted, about 20 minutes.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 316.6 calories, Carbohydrate 6.5 g, Cholesterol 90.2 mg, Fat 23.8 g, Fiber 0.8 g, Protein 18.9 g, SaturatedFat 13.3 g, Sodium 799.5 mg, Sugar 2.3 g
HOT BAKED TACO DIP
This hot taco dip is perfect with tortilla chips and is always a crowd pleaser.
Provided by shae
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Dips and Spreads Recipes Cheese Dips and Spreads Recipes
Time 35m
Yield 20
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Spray a 9x13-inch casserole dish with cooking spray.
-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ook and stir beef in the hot skillet until browned and crumbly, 5 to 7 minutes; drain and discard grease. Stir bell pepper and taco seasoning into ground beef. Spread ground beef mixture into prepared casserole dish.
- Sprinkle tomato and green onions over ground beef mixture; top with taco sauce. Spread sour cream over taco sauce layer and top with Cheddar cheese.
- Bake in the preheated oven until cheese is melted and bubbling, 10 to 20 minutes. Serve with tortilla chips.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 253.6 calories, Carbohydrate 17.1 g, Cholesterol 35.7 mg, Fat 16.8 g, Fiber 1.6 g, Protein 9.2 g, SaturatedFat 7.3 g, Sodium 319.1 mg, Sugar 1.2 g

BAKED TACO 'DIP' BITES
Inspired by a beloved dip, our Baked Taco 'Dip' Bites are utterly delicious. With only 20 minutes of prep, they're simple to make, too. So try a new take on flavors you know they already adore with these Baked Taco 'Dip' Bites.
Provided by My Food and Family
Categories Festive 2019
Time 2h13m
Yield 12 servings, 3 squares each
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Heat oven to 325ºF.
- Line 8-inch square pan with foil, with ends of foil extending over sides. Combine cracker crumbs and butter; press onto bottom of prepared pan. Bake 8 min.
- Meanwhile, beat cream cheese and taco seasoning mix in medium bowl with mixer until blended. Add eggs, 1 at a time, mixing on low speed after each just until blended. Stir in shredded cheese.
- Spread cream cheese mixture onto crust.
- Bake 20 to 23 min. or until center is almost set. Cool completely.
- Refrigerate 1 hour.
- Use foil handles to remove taco 'dip' from pan; cut into 36 squares.
- Top each square with about 1/4 tsp. each sour cream and salsa before serving.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 230, Fat 20 g, SaturatedFat 11 g, TransFat 0.5 g, Cholesterol 85 mg, Sodium 380 mg, Carbohydrate 0 g, Fiber 0 g, Sugar 0 g, Protein 5 g
